Personality of people born on October 20
People born on October 20 carry a distinctly relational version of Libra energy. Libra is a cardinal air sign ruled by Venus, so this birthday often combines initiative with social intelligence: the person does not only notice harmony, they tend to want to create it. October 20 adds the Pythagorean day number 2, which deepens the themes of cooperation, tact, receptivity, and partnership. Together, these influences often describe someone who reads rooms quickly, senses imbalance early, and prefers to guide situations toward fairness rather than force outcomes.
This is not the loudest expression of leadership, yet it can be an influential one. October 20 people frequently lead through tone, timing, mediation, and design. They may have a gift for choosing the right words, softening extremes, or spotting the one adjustment that makes a relationship, project, or environment feel more livable. Venus adds aesthetic intelligence, so beauty is rarely superficial here. In practice, it often connects to proportion, atmosphere, social grace, and the feeling that things are arranged with care.
The challenge is that Libra’s weighing mind and the 2’s partnership instinct can amplify hesitation. October 20 births often see more than one valid side, and that empathy is a strength until it turns into delay, over-accommodation, or people-pleasing. They may spend too long keeping peace externally while uncertainty grows internally. At their best, though, they show that diplomacy is not weakness. For this exact birthday, the personality theme is balanced responsiveness: knowing how to cooperate without disappearing, and how to pursue beauty and fairness without losing one’s own voice.
Symbols: birthstone, birth flower, and the day-number tradition
The symbols for October 20 fit together with unusual precision. Libra already points toward balance, elegance, and relationship awareness. Day number 2 reinforces cooperation and sensitivity to subtle emotional currents. Then the October birthstone, Opal, adds a shifting, prismatic quality that mirrors this birthday’s many-sided perception. Opal is traditionally linked with imagination, emotional nuance, and the ability to hold contrasts at once. That symbolism suits October 20 especially well, because these individuals often notice layered motives, mixed feelings, and the changing color of a situation long before others do.
The alternate stone, Tourmaline, offers a useful counterpoint. Where Opal reflects multiplicity and fluidity, Tourmaline is often read as a symbol of range with structure: many colors, but held in a more grounded form. For October 20, that pairing is meaningful. It suggests a life lesson of honoring sensitivity without scattering it. Libra and the 2 can be exquisitely responsive, and Tourmaline symbolism reminds this birthday to channel that responsiveness into clear values and defined choices.
The birth flower, Marigold, brings warmth, courage, and vivid presence. This is important because October 20 can lean so strongly toward tact and accommodation that stronger self-expression may need encouragement. Marigold symbolism introduces brightness and conviction, as if to say that harmony is healthiest when it includes honest color. The alternate flower, Cosmos, echoes Libra beautifully through order, symmetry, and graceful simplicity. Cosmos suggests elegance born from proportion, not excess.
Seen together, the symbols for October 20 describe a person who often thrives by blending softness with clarity: Libra’s fairness, the 2’s partnership energy, Opal’s emotional complexity, and Marigold’s brave warmth. The day’s symbolism does not push blunt force. It favors attunement, refined judgment, and relationships shaped with intention.
Strengths, shadow patterns, and the inner work of this birthday
The clearest strengths of October 20 are diplomacy, fairness, aesthetic intelligence, and emotional tact. These people frequently understand that how something is said matters nearly as much as what is said. They often excel in spaces where competing interests need translation rather than conquest. Libra’s cardinal quality gives initiative, but because it operates through air and Venus, it tends to show up as social strategy, intelligent framing, and tasteful presentation. Day number 2 adds listening skills and an instinct for pairing, collaboration, and mutual support.
This can make October 20 individuals excellent mediators, editors, designers, hosts, partners, and teammates. They often sense where friction comes from and how to reduce it without humiliating anyone. Their eye for beauty may also carry moral weight: they tend to prefer arrangements that feel fair, balanced, and humane, not merely attractive.
The shadow patterns are just as specific. Libra can become trapped in comparison, and the 2 can become overly dependent on external feedback. For October 20, this may appear as indecision disguised as thoughtfulness, conflict avoidance disguised as kindness, or people-pleasing disguised as diplomacy. Opal symbolism adds another layer: emotional and imaginative richness can become overstimulation if not grounded. Marigold helps here by representing warmth with backbone. It suggests that peace sometimes needs candor, not just tact.
The inner work of this birthday often centers on strengthening preference. Not every choice can be made elegant for everyone involved, and maturity may come from tolerating that discomfort. October 20 people tend to grow when they learn to say, with calm clarity, “This is what I think is fair,” even if not everyone agrees. They also benefit from distinguishing true cooperation from self-erasure. Their gift is real harmony, not performance harmony. When they trust their own taste and judgment, their natural grace becomes far more effective and less draining.

Compatibility and what to watch in love, friendship, and career
October 20 tends to do best with people who respect reciprocity. In love, friendship, and work, this birthday often seeks mutual effort, thoughtful communication, and an atmosphere that feels civilized rather than chaotic. Libra plus day number 2 usually values partnership deeply, so relationships often become a major arena of growth. These individuals frequently bond well with those who appreciate beauty, fairness, and collaboration, but who also help bring decisions to closure.
In romance, they often respond to kindness, refinement, and genuine listening. Trouble can begin when they smooth over too much or expect unspoken signals to be understood. Because this date is so attuned to tone, harshness or chronic imbalance can feel especially draining. In friendship, they are often generous mediators, though they may need to watch the habit of becoming the group’s emotional adjuster. A healthy circle lets them receive support as well as give it.
Career-wise, October 20 frequently suits roles involving negotiation, design, advising, editing, diplomacy, client care, partnership management, or any field where judgment and presentation matter together. Opal and Libra suggest creativity and nuance; Marigold adds visibility and warmth; the 2 supports teamwork. The main caution is over-deliberation. In practice, success often grows when they set clearer timelines, name their preferences earlier, and remember that fairness does not require endless deferral.
